Before buying two more batteries for my Phantom, I had one thought in my mind: ONE and ONLY battery model for Phantom 2, Vision and Vision Plus.

But when I received the batteries, I could notice a model difference and a slightly difference between these ones and the two ones that came with my V2 Vision Plus. See the attached image.

image.jpg
On the left, there is the model that came with my Phantom (733496-5200mAh-11.1V), and on the right, the model that I've just bought (PH2-5200mAh-11.1V).

I've seen some posts saying that this PH2 battery has improved cells and stuff, but they deliver less voltage when full throttle.

Do you guys know anything regarding these models, that could help me?
